Solar power from the mountains

According to a Swiss study, solar parks in the mountains need less space than photovoltaic systems in the lowlands. In addition, they produce more electricity in winter and can better serve the seasonally fluctuating electricity demand.

Why are solar panels installed on mountain tops?

Solar panels placed on mountain-tops get direct rays of sunshine with fewer cloud interference. The air at high altitudes is better at cooling solar cells. This increases their performance. Solar panels can be installed at steeper angles, increasing the amount of sun that hits their surface. Getting power to mountainous areas is a challenge.

Do alpine solar plants produce more electricity?

"One of the qualities of alpine solar plants is that, especially in winter, they produce up to three times more electricity than a comparable facility in the midlands," says Jeanette Schranz, communications lead for renewables at Swiss energy producer Axpo.

Is solar power more efficient at higher altitudes?

Solar power generation is more efficient at higher altitudes, but limitations exist. An increase in solar radiation exposure leads to a higher surface temperature on your panels. Typically, panels reach their peak efficiency above 60°F and below 95°F.
